WebAnswer (1 of 7): The flu is a virus; with a virus, the white blood cell count is usually normal or low, not elevated. WBC count goes up with a bacterial infection, or stress, though. WebA normal white blood cell count is generally about 4,500 to 11,000/μL. White blood cell counts that are too high or too low may be dangerous, depending on the cause. A high …
